  • Publication number: 20210116983
    Abstract: Methods, apparatus, systems and articles of manufacture for acoustic system noise mitigation are disclosed. An example apparatus includes a sound sensor and one or more electronic components. The apparatus also includes a background noise analyzer to obtain sensor data indicative of background noise in an environment of the apparatus from the sound sensor. The apparatus also includes a system noise analyzer to select a first system noise profile indicative of acoustic noise associated with operating the one or more electronic components according to a first system configuration. The apparatus also includes a system noise controller to operate the one or more electronic components according to the first system configuration of the first system noise profile.

  • Publication number: 20190377405
    Abstract: In some examples, a voltage protection apparatus includes a circuit to compare an input voltage of a processor to a threshold voltage, and to provide a throttle signal to the processor if the input voltage of the processor droops below the threshold voltage. The processor input voltage can then be set to a lower voltage and the processor power can thus be lowered.

  • Patent number: 10204068
    Abstract: Some embodiments include apparatuses and methods having a node to couple to a serial bus, and a controller to provide a control signal to one of a first circuit path and a second circuit path in order to change electrical termination of a signal at the node between a first electrical termination through the first circuit path during a first mode of the controller and a second electrical termination through the second circuit path during a second mode of the controller. The controller can be arranged to provide the control signal to the first and second circuit paths during the first and second modes without providing another control signal from the controller to the first and second circuit paths during the first and second modes.

  • Patent number: 5959442
    Abstract: A voltage converter for converting an input voltage to a different output voltage includes an output filter for providing the output voltage and a voltage switch coupled in series between the input voltage and the output filter. A controller compares the output voltage to a reference voltage and in response thereto, provides signals to turn the voltage switch on or off. A level shifter is coupled between the controller and the voltage switch.
